This beret is constructed in the style of a lace doily with a center start and repeating medallions. The beret is flattering and lightweight for fashionable wear without flattening your hairdo.
Detailed instructions are included for a type of circular center start that can help you practice for actual doilies you might want to make later in lighter weight threads and smaller needles.
Pictured in SpinningBunny Hand Dyed Yarn, color Blueberry Pie
Finished diameter of crown is 10 - 11 inches depending on size of dinner plate used for blocking. Requires 125 yards fingering weight yarn and knitting needles sizes US 3 through 6 (3.25 - 4 mm). Includes charted and written stitch instructions, as well as detailed blocking instructions with photos.
